So, things are a little out of order at this point, but I’m sure you guys won’t mind. I showed you some of my favorite guest photos from the big day, and now I want to jump back 48 hours to the beginning of our wedding weekend. See? It’s not that confusing. ;)

We officially started our wedding weekend with the arrival of some very important people on Thursday afternoon. Namely, our officiant and MIL & FIL Coach. Following their arrival, Mr. C and I headed down to the hotel they were staying at, and FIL Coach treated us all to a delicious dinner at Truluck’s (mmm, steak and seafood!). Side note: Earlier that day, Mr. C and I actually made a reservation for dinner at the WRONG restaurant location. I was in wedding mode and handed him the phone, which was already calling another Truluck’s in downtown Dallas, not the location we were heading to. Luckily, they made room for us and everything worked out, but I do suggest letting someone else handle details like that when you have a little case of wedding brain the days before the wedding!

After the rehearsal, and a few more pictures in front of the Piazza, we all headed over the Brio Tuscan Grille (highly recommended!), where we enjoyed nothing short of a feast. The food was great, and we loved the private room that we had reserved for our dinner. We reserved two-thirds of Brio’s party room—I know it sounds weird, but they let you reserve sections based on how many people you have, and each section you use increases the minimum. Ideally, we would’ve liked to have had the space of all three sections, but someone had already reserved part of it. So we just got a little cozy and then chowed down! There were two long tables like you see below, so Mr. C and I just made our rounds to talk with everyone in between stuffing our faces with all of the tasty food. ;)
